I just wrote up my method for building a headless Ubuntu 16.04 LTS 6 gpu mining rig for Zcash. This one runs Claymore 10.0.

The entire BOM list is included, and the entire Linux setup, with the scripts I use. If anyone has time to look at it and offer suggestions, I’d appreciate it. This is a guide that a noob should be able to use.

I’m using Sapphire Radeon Fury 9’s. Total for 6 GPU’s is 2055 H/s. They use a LOT of power though. I’m thinking I should use the RX480’s instead because they are more flexible and over a year or two will end up saving me money. At 240VAC the mining rig is pulling about 7 amps. That’s 1600 Watts!

The other problem I have is finding good PCIE risers. Whatever brand I choose, about half of them are bad - either right away with a short, or after running for a few minutes.

Claymore V10
-HD 7950 225h/s
-HD 7870 Tahiti 150h/s
Claymore V11
-HD 7950 253h/s with asm 1 :slight_smile:
-HD 7870 152h/s
